About CRESCENT ES
What is the total enrollment at CRESCENT ES?
CRESCENT ES enrolls approximately 308 students in grades PK-06.
What age range does CRESCENT ES serve?
CRESCENT ES serves students from grade PK through grade 06.
How many teachers does CRESCENT ES have?
CRESCENT ES employs 18 FTE teachers, for a student-to-teacher ratio of 17.4:1.
How diverse is CRESCENT ES?
CRESCENT ES reports a student body of 75% White, 3% Hispanic, 6% Black, 4% Two or more.
